Real Madrid star Marco Asensio will reportedly take a pay cut this summer if it means leaving the club, with Arsenal and Liverpool both rumoured to be keen on signing the Spaniard.

According to TuttoMercatoWeb, the 26-year-old winger is desperate to leave the La Liga champions this summer, so much so that Asensio is will to take a smaller wage elsewhere if it means leaving Madrid, with the likes of Arsenal, AC Milan and Liverpool all interested in the Madrid star.

Despite featuring heavily last season for Carlo Ancelotti and having his best goalscoring campaign to date with 12 goals in all competitions, Asensio looks desperate to leave Madrid following on from their league and UEFA Champions League-winning campaign, and Arsenal or Liverpool could now sign the attacker.

Indeed, Liverpool, in particular, have been heavily linked with a move for Asensio this summer, with the Reds keen on signing the Spanish international as a potential replacement for Sadio Mane, who left for Bayern Munich earlier in the transfer window.

Whilst Jurgen Klopp has already paid a club-record fee to sign Uruguyan international Darwin Nunez, it appears that Liverpool want more this summer, and Asensio could be an outstanding option for the Anfield side if they can beat Mikel Arteta and Milan to the winger’s signature.
